In the challenging industry of biotechnology, Andelyn Biosciences has come forth as a forerunner, advancing groundbreaking therapies and contributing substantially to the biopharmaceutical field. Started in 2020, the firm, based in Columbus, Ohio, was founded out of Nationwide Children's Hospital's Abigail Wexner Research Institute along with a mission to accelerating the refinement and manufacturing of innovative therapies to bring more treatments to more patients.

Biological Delivery Systems
Microbes have developed to seamlessly deliver nucleic acids into host cells, making them an effective tool for DNA-based treatment. Frequently employed virus-based carriers consist of:
Adenoviruses – Designed to invade both proliferating and quiescent cells but can elicit host defenses.
Adeno-Associated Viruses (AAVs) – Preferred due to their minimal antigenicity and ability to sustain prolonged genetic activity.
Retroviral vectors and lentiviral systems – Embed within the cellular DNA, providing stable gene expression, with lentiviruses being particularly beneficial for modifying quiescent cells.
Non-Viral Vectors
Synthetic genetic modification approaches offer a reduced-risk option, reducing the risk of immune reactions. These comprise:
Lipid-based carriers and nano-delivery systems – Packaging genetic sequences for effective cellular uptake.
Electrical Permeabilization – Using electrical pulses to generate permeable spots in cell membranes, facilitating DNA/RNA penetration.
Direct Injection –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into target tissues.

Treatment of Genetic Disorders
Many genetic disorders result from single-gene mutations, positioning them as prime subjects for genetic correction. Some notable advancements encompass:
CFTR Mutation Disorder – Efforts to introduce working CFTR sequences have demonstrated positive outcomes.
Hemophilia – Genetic modification research seek to reestablish the generation of hemostatic molecules.
Dystrophic Muscle Disorders – CRISPR-driven genetic correction delivers promise for individuals this content with DMD.
Sickle Cell Disease and Beta-Thalassemia – DNA correction techniques focus on correcting red blood cell abnormalities.
Cancer Gene Therapy
Genetic modification is integral in cancer treatment, either by engineering lymphocytes to recognize and attack tumors or by directly altering cancerous cells to halt metastasis. Several highly effective tumor-targeted genetic solutions include:
CAR-T Cell Therapy – Reprogrammed immune cells targeting specific cancer antigens.
Oncolytic Viruses – Bioengineered viral entities that selectively infect and eliminate malignant tissues.
Reactivation of Oncogene Inhibitors – Reestablishing the efficacy of genes like TP53 to control proliferation.
Curing of Communicable Disorders
Gene therapy presents prospective remedies for long-term pathologies notably Human Immunodeficiency Virus. Developmental procedures feature:
Genome-edited HIV Cure – Targeting and wiping out pathogen-bearing cells.
DNA Alteration of T Cells – Transforming T cells immune to HIV entry.

Gene Therapy: Transforming the Fundamental Biology
Gene therapy operates via repairing the genetic basis of chromosomal abnormalities:
In-Body Gene Treatment: Administers therapeutic genes immediately within the biological structure, for example the regulatory-approved Spark Therapeutics’ Luxturna for curing genetic vision loss.
Ex Vivo Gene Therapy: Utilizes genetically altering a individual’s tissues externally and then reintroducing them, as seen in some investigative protocols for hemoglobinopathy conditions and immune system failures.
The advent of precision DNA-editing has further accelerated gene therapy scientific exploration, enabling precise modifications at the chromosomal sequences.
